Transaction 3995ef82d92de458ae82c4f0c88632c4c9aa02ea4f74427b0f1eb9c773d9be3f

71 Input
2 Outputs
  • 3995ef82d92de458ae82c4f0c88632c4c9aa02ea4f74427b0f1eb9c773d9be3f:0
  • value  27846
    address  14YrpGCY2Q8oNKeGEKBN1oZrF8pN5vVGax
  • 3995ef82d92de458ae82c4f0c88632c4c9aa02ea4f74427b0f1eb9c773d9be3f:1
  • value  5520000
    address  3QdWu5GXvuTisY7YL2VhV4grdL3xDXjPjj